KFC Franchise Cost in India

Among the key considerations for anyone thinking about looking for a KFC franchise in India is the expense. Setting up a KFC franchise needs a considerable financial commitment due to the brand's premium placing in the market. The initial franchise expense includes the franchise fee, real estate investment, devices, inventory, and other operational expenditures.

The cost of a KFC franchise in India differs depending upon the location and size of the restaurant. In major cities where real estate prices are greater, the investment needed may be considerably more than in smaller sized cities or towns. On average, the expense to set up a KFC franchise in India varies from INR 1 crore to INR 2.5 crore. This includes expenditures such as the franchise charge, construction of the outlet, devices, and the initial stock needed to start operations. The franchise cost alone can range in between INR 30 lakhs to INR 50 lakhs, depending on the location and market conditions.

In 2024, KFC continues to use profitable franchise chances, and the cost of developing a franchise has remained competitive in contrast to other international fast-food chains. Nevertheless, it is necessary to have a thorough financial plan in place to cover both the initial investment and the ongoing operational costs such as personnel wages, utilities, and marketing expenditures.

How to Apply for a KFC Franchise

Making an application for a KFC franchise is a multi-step procedure that requires a comprehensive understanding of the brand's requirements and expectations. Possible franchisees must first guarantee they meet KFC's financial and operational criteria before sending an application.

The first step in obtaining a KFC franchise in India is to reveal your interest through the official KFC franchise website or through the franchisor's designated agents in the nation. The online application form requires information about your financial standing, business experience, and your proposed location for the franchise.

When your application is sent, it is reviewed by the KFC franchise team to assess whether you satisfy the eligibility requirements. This consists of financial capacity, experience in the food and beverage industry, and an understanding of the local market. After a preliminary review, effective candidates are invited to go to a series of interviews and conversations to more explore their viability as franchisees.

KFC Franchise in India: Success Factors

Several factors add to the success of a KFC franchise in India To start with, the location of the franchise plays a critical function in bring in consumers. High tramp areas such as mall, industrial centres, and largely populated houses are ideal for KFC outlets. KFC provides assistance in recognizing ideal locations and establishing the franchise.

Furthermore, adherence to KFC's stringent quality standards is essential. The brand's reputation counts on keeping consistency in food quality, hygiene, and customer support across all outlets. Franchisees must follow KFC's operational standards, consisting of food preparation methods, cooking area setup, and employee training. KFC likewise provides extensive training programs for franchise owners and their staff to guarantee they satisfy the brand's high standards.

Marketing and promotions are another vital element of running an effective KFC franchise. While KFC conducts nationwide advertising campaigns, individual franchisees are motivated to participate in local marketing efforts to attract consumers. This can consist of participating in community events, using unique promotions, or teaming up with local businesses.
